There were 3 droids.
Survey (useless if spotted by enemies)
Probe (blaster style projectile, could rape a base if it went unnoticed, long enough)
Suicide (mortar style projectile, made everyone and their mother rage quit)

All 3 used the camera shapefile, and could fly past turrets without getting targeted.

I wanted to create one that teleported it's pilot to it's position when it was triggered, and could fly through walls like ghost armor, but I couldn't figure out how to make a flier go through walls like a player could.

Ghost armor's collision box is 2 dimensional, which is why it can't go through floors and ceilings, but it can go through walls facing any direction. If it had no dimensions, it could go through floors and ceilings too. However, vehicles don't have collision boxes in their datablocks.
